The clock is ticking! Members of the military who were recently deployed have to be under contract by April 30, 2011, to possibly qualify for the first-time homebuyer credit.  Military or certain federal employees must have served on qualified official duty outside of the United States for at least 90 days during the time period after December 31, 2008, and before May 1, 2010. The credit could be up to $8,000.
